Abstract

Background: During recent COVID-19 pandemic, health professionals were faced with a tremendous workload and had to make difficult decisions. As in similar pandemics in the past, health professionals had reported anxiety, low mood and increased stress, resulting in psychological distress. Aim: This study aimed to examine the validity and the reliability of a new measurement tool, the COVID-19 anxiety questionnaire in the Greek medical doctors. The tool aimed to assess distress in doctors who worked in hospital during COVID-19 pandemic. Methods: The Perceived Stress Scale (PSS), the Depression Anxiety Stress scale (DASS) were used together with the COVID-19 anxiety scale. Also, certain sociodemographic characteristics were assessed. Exploratory Factor Analysis (EFA) was used to identify possible factors from C-19 Anxiety scale. Cronbach’s a and Spearman’s rho were also used. Results: The sample consisted of 179 Greek medical doctors (87.2% males) with mean age 50.73 years. The results of EFA results indicated only one factor for the COVID-19 Anxiety scale (2 questions were excluded from the final factor due to small loadings) which explained the 65.38% of total variance. Cronbach’s a was 0.967 and COVID-19 anxiety scale was positively correlated with PSS-14 (p<0.001) and the 2 subscales of DASS-21 (Stress and Depression) (p<0.001 for both subscales), while it was negatively correlated with DASS-Anxiety (p<0.05). Conclusion: The findings of this study showed that the Greek version of C-19 Anxiety questionnaire has good psychometric properties and can be safely used in future studies.
